Job Description

About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Compliance Monitoring Officer to join our team in Somerset West, responsible for ensuring that clients’ due diligence is collected to the appropriate standard in line with our internal policies and procedures. This role involves conducting periodic reviews, monitoring automated screening systems, and providing guidance on compliance matters.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ct Periodic Reviews of client due diligence
  • Record deficiencies and generate action points for remediation
  • Conduct client screening using our screening system and open-source searches
  • Monitor and analyse the results of automated ongoing screening system
  • Conduct research on relevant parties where potential adverse matches are identified
  • Assist in the development, implementation, and continuous improvement of internal policies and procedures
  • Develop and deliver training materials for staff members on compliance topics
  • Provide day-to-day support/guidance to staff on compliance and AML/CFT/CPF matters
  • Participate in training sessions to increase knowledge and understanding of regulatory environment
  • Complete other duties as required to drive business success

About Legal Jobs in Cape Town Region

Cape Town is a thriving hub for legal professionals in South Africa, with many multinationals and local companies operating in the region. The job market trends for this field are generally strong, with an increasing demand for skilled lawyers and legal advisors. Typically, these roles require a strong educational background, combined with relevant work experience and a good understanding of the local legal landscape.

When it comes to salary expectations, it’s common for lawyers and legal professionals in Cape Town to earn between R500 000 to R1 million per annum, depending on factors such as their level of experience, the size of the company they work for, and the industry sector. However, salaries can vary widely, and actual figures may be higher or lower than these broad ranges. For example, senior lawyers in certain industries may earn significantly more, while entry-level professionals may start at a lower salary.

In terms of common skills required for this type of role, typically, lawyers and legal professionals need to possess strong analytical and problem-solving skills, as well as excellent communication and interpersonal skills. A good understanding of the law and regulatory requirements is also essential, particularly in industries such as financial services, technology, and manufacturing. Additionally, many companies require their lawyers to have experience working with technology and data analytics tools, as well as a basic understanding of digital transformation and its implications for business.

Many industries commonly employ lawyers and legal professionals in Cape Town, including the financial services sector, the technology industry, and manufacturing sector. The demand for skilled lawyers is also strong in sectors such as construction, energy, and natural resources.
